Is the Pro Football Hall of Fame teasing Steelers Nation and Troy Polamalu fans with a hint of what’s to come this weekend?

Polamalu’s sons were each given a commemorative Hall of Fame pin by HOF President and CEO David Baker on Thursday night. A video of the interaction was posted on Twitter.

Polamalu is a first-time eligible candidate for the Hall of Fame. If the former safety is elected as part of the class of 2020, it will be announced Saturday.

Polamalu played with the Pittsburgh Steelers for 12 years.
